Stick-nest Rat 2
The stick habitations will reach 3 ft in height and
4 ft in width. Secured by large stones the nest is secure in high winds
and in the possible attack of a predator. Within the larger structure are smaller grassy nests. Once
hunted by the Aborigines the primary predators of the stick-nest rat are cave owls. Stick-nest rats
are found in Australia and on the surrounding islands.
